中职计算机基础课程?

237 2023-10-26 07:01

一、中职计算机基础课程?

,根据培养目标不同,课程设置的也有所差别,还有看你选择的专业以及方向计算机应用与维修,主要开始的是:计算机故障诊断与处理,计算机组装与维护,计算机应用基础,常用工具,计算机组成原理,网络技术基础,网络综合布线等

二、计算机基础都学什么课程?

作为一个科班的计算机学生,由于不同学校之间的差异,课程的设计上可能会有一些少量的差异,那么作为计算机专业(此处我们指:计算机科学与技术)的学生来说,最应该学习的前 5 个课程应该是什么呢?

由于计算机科学是一个学科体系,所以并不能说,只要会写程序就算是一个计算机科学的学生,而需要对于一个体系的知识都有一定的了解,下面按照分类和体系进行说明:

基础(底层)

计算机是由数学发展而来的,所以对于计算机的专业来说,一定要有一些数学的基础,在这个方面最需要学习的课程是:

《线性代数》和《离散数学》。

线性代数作为很多学科的基础,其中矩阵的概念是后期计算机图形学,机器学习的基础,离散数学可以帮助我们在后期的数据库等课程中提供一个非常夯实的理论基础(当然,你得学好)

硬件(中层)

由于是计算机科学的课程而不是软件工程,对于硬件的一些了解也是一个必须的过程,在这个方面结合了许多了学校的课程安排之后总结出以下最需要的课程:

《计算机组成原理》和《计算机系统与结构》。

前者可以告诉我们计算机内部的运作结构,了解计算机硬件方面的指令以及相关实现原则,后者作为前者更加靠近指令和软件一些,作 8086 的 PC 为一个衔接,可以提供更多的计算机系统方面运行的原理和调度的原理。

软件(偏上层)

有了以上基础和一些硬件方面的知识基础之后,我们就可以开始软件方面的探索了,在软件方面,由于是计算机科学课程而非软件工程,我们专业会更加侧重于算法,数据结构等方面的知识,在这个方面上:

《算法与数据结构》,《数据库原理概论》,《计算机网络》

等课程就是非常有必要的了,这个部分或许是我们传统认为的计算机科学学生需要去学习的一些主流课程。

算法与数据结构让我们了解目前已有的优秀算法,通过对这方面的了解我们可以写出更加优秀的算法,提升一些组成部分的计算效率。

数据库原理课程的设计让我们了解到一个非常重要的组成部分 —— 数据库的概念以及原理,由于有了算法与数据结构的理解我们可以理解现代数据库中对于数据的规划和存储方案,在学习到优秀设计的同时也可以指导后期在软件设计方面对于数据存储的规划。

而计算机网络,则描述了我们生活中接触到最多的一个组成部分,我们学习的不仅仅是网络怎么调通(这个是专科学生需要理解的事情),还要理解为什么网络是通的,以及在需要的时候我们该如何去设计一个优秀的网络结构。

三、计算机专业基础课程有哪些?

我大学学的是计算机科学于技术,计算机的基础课程的不少,基本上大学学的好多都是,搞软件有C语言,数据结构,软件工程等,硬件有数字逻辑,计算机系统结构,计算机组成原理,操作系统也是很重要的基础课程,如果要学网络,那计算机网络是基础,搞和数据库有关的工作,数据库很重要,对于不同的发展方向,有不同的专业基础课,主要看你从事哪一项,比如说你从事软件,那计算机网络,数据库等一些课程就没那么重要

四、833计算机专业基础是哪几门课程?

包含三门课程:数据结构,计算机组织,体系结构

五、大学计算机基础课程都学什么?

大学计算机基础课程通常涉及以下方面:

计算机组成原理:学习计算机硬件的组成、工作原理和操作系统的基本原理。

数据结构和算法:学习常见的数据结构(如数组、链表、栈、队列、树和图)以及算法(如排序、查找、递归等)的使用和分析。

计算机网络:学习网络协议、网络拓扑、网络设备(如路由器、交换机等)的使用和网络安全。

操作系统:学习操作系统的基本原理、进程管理、文件系统等。

数据库:学习数据库的概念、关系型数据库的设计和管理、SQL语言的使用。

编程语言:学习常见的编程语言(如C、C++、Java、Python等)的语法、数据类型、控制结构和函数等。

软件工程:学习软件开发的流程、工具(如版本控制工具、测试工具等)的使用以及代码质量的评估。

以上只是大学计算机基础课程中的一部分,具体内容和难易程度会因学校和课程的不同而有所不同。

六、对口计算机专业基础课程有哪些?

计算机对口升学考试一般包括以下几个方面:

1.计算机基础知识:包括计算机组成原理、操作系统、计算机网络、数据库等基础知识。

2.编程语言:包括C语言、Java、Python等编程语言的基础知识和应用能力。

3.算法和数据结构:包括常见的算法和数据结构,如排序、查找、树、图等。

4.软件工程:包括软件开发过程、需求分析、设计、测试等软件工程知识。

5.计算机应用:包括计算机图形学、计算机辅助设计、计算机辅助制造等应用领域的知识。

6.计算机安全:包括计算机网络安全、信息安全、数据安全等方面的知识。

以上是计算机对口升学考试的一些主要内容,不同学校和专业的考试内容可能会有所不同,具体以各自学校和专业的要求为准

七、学习计算机的基础课程有哪些?

数据结构与算法:

《大话数据结构》 《啊哈!算法》 《算法图解》

计算机组成原理 :

《深入理解计算机系统》

计算机网络 :

《计算机网络》谢希仁 《图解HTTP》《TCP/IP详解1:协议》

操作系统 :

《现代操作系统》《UNIX环境高级编程》

数据库原理 :

《数据库系统概论》《MySQL必知必会》

编译原理 :

《编译原理》

离散数学 :

《离散数学及其应用》

Linux :

《鸟哥的Linux私房菜》

资料扩展:

计算机专业是指计算机硬件与软件相结合、面向系统、更偏向应用的宽口径专业。通过基础教学与专业训练,培养基础知识扎实、知识面宽、工程实践能力强,具有开拓创新意识,在计算机科学与技术领域从事科学研究、教育、开发和应用的高级人才。

计算机学科的特色主要体现在:理论性强,实践性强,发展迅速按一级学科培养基础扎实的宽口径人才,体现在重视数学、逻辑、数据结构、算法、电子设计、计算机体系结构和系统软件等方面的理论基础和专业技术基础,前两年半注重自然科学基础课程和专业基础课程,拓宽面向。后一年半主要是专业课程的设置,增加可选性、多样性、灵活性和方向性,突出学科方向特色,体现最新技术发展动向。

在这个网络时代,想要学好计算机还是要下一定功夫的,抓紧学起来吧~

八、计算机技术的基础课程有哪些?

计算机技术的基础课程包括以下内容:

1. 计算机组成原理:介绍计算机硬件系统结构、组成和工作原理,包括处理器、存储器、输入输出设备和总线等。

2. 数据结构:介绍数据在计算机内部的组织形式与算法,包括线性表、树、图等。

3. 操作系统:介绍计算机操作系统的原理、构成和功能,包括进程管理、存储器管理、文件管理和网络管理等。

4. 编译原理:介绍程序的编译过程,包括文法定义、词法分析、语法分析、代码生成等。

5. 计算机网络:介绍计算机网络的原理、协议和体系结构,包括物理层、数据链路层、网络层、传输层和应用层等。

6. 数据库系统:介绍数据库的概念、模型和技术,包括数据模型、关系代数、数据库设计、SQL语言和存储过程等。

7. 软件工程:介绍软件开发的过程、方法和工具,包括软件工程的原理、模型和流程,软件测试和质量管理等。

以上课程是计算机科学专业的基础课程,学生在学习这些课程后,可以对计算机技术的各个方面有一个全面的了解,为未来的实践应用奠定坚实的基础。

九、专业基础课程和基础课程的区别?

答:专业基础课程和基础课程的区别在于,专业基础课程是指专业基础学科的课程,比如,师范大学,他的专业基础课程就是大学语文,数学,历史,地理,化学,物理,英语等等各科教学内容。

而基础课程是指不论是学习哪门专业,都必须要学习和掌握的基础课程,比如,语文,数学,英语等等基础知识。

十、计算机软件编程的基础课程有哪些?

课程设置分三类:

第一类课程实行边教学边实践,课堂教学讲基本原理、基本方法;实践教学给出小型实践题目,循序渐进。

这类课程除常规的计算机专业课程外,还要加入软件工程,对象和组件技术等;第二类课程主要进行理论方法教学,逐步积累,集中时间进行实践教学。这类课程有:操作系统、编译原理、数据库系统、网络与网络工程、软件成熟度模型(CMM)。

第三类课程是综合多门课程的知识,与科研项目相结合,以不同的目标或不同的应用作为实践的大型课程设计,如大型程序设计方法课程设计、大型应用软件课程设计等。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片